Biography

Margaret Sarah Hardy was born in 1863 in Anglesey, Wales, daughter of Thomas Hardy, an engineer, and his wife Jane nee Williams.[1] In 1881, aged 17, Margaret was working as a ladies' maid in Chester.[2] In her late teens or early twenties she became the mistress of Dugald Scott, a Lancashire cotton manufacturer, and had five children with him, living under the pseudonym of Mrs. Margaret Stewart.[3][4]

Dugald and Margaret finally married in Manchester in 1910, a year after his mother died.[5][6] He was 58 and she was 45. It is unclear whether he ever formally acknowledged his children after the marriage. In 1911, Margaret was still living with the children in Liverpool under her assumed name, while Dugald stayed at a hotel in Cheshire.[7][8]

Dugald died in 1920 in Hampshire and Margaret died in Tonbridge, Kent in 1938.[9]

Research Notes

The details of the above profile are tentative. They have been pieced together from publicly available records.

One telling detail: in the 1911 census, Margaret had two visitors, Charles Sproule and his wife. This was Charles Randall Sproule, a friend of Dugald's who had been a witness at their wedding the year before.

Margaret seems to have died in Tonbridge, which may mean that she was in contact with Dugald's younger sister Gertrude Hancock, who also lived in Tonbridge.
